Transaction 20da72dfd38a0d9dbffb709e158621ea5465ac0d845c11b28c36809c7db1518f

5 Input
1 Outputs
  • 20da72dfd38a0d9dbffb709e158621ea5465ac0d845c11b28c36809c7db1518f:0
  • value  43063105
    address  14eBf1uxWAWPgWzqwixKmx9WgKJRHEnpiw